Leaking Basement Repair in Tuscaloosa, AL
Leaking basement repair services address issues related to water infiltration that can compromise the integrity and safety of a property. These projects typically include identifying sources of leaks, such as cracks in foundation walls, faulty drainage systems, or plumbing failures, and implementing effective solutions to prevent further water intrusion. Property owners often seek these services when noticing dampness, mold growth, or standing water in the basement, aiming to protect their home’s structure and maintain a healthy living environment.
Before requesting leaking basement repairs, homeowners should understand the extent of the water intrusion and any underlying causes. It’s important to consider factors like the age of the foundation, recent weather conditions, and existing drainage systems. Clear communication about the specific issues experienced, along with any previous repairs, can help determine the most appropriate solutions. Proper assessment and planning ensure that repairs effectively address current problems and help prevent future water-related damage.

Common Leaking Basement Repair Jobs
Basement wall sealing - prevents water from seeping through cracks and porous surfaces.
Drainage system installation - redirects water away from the foundation to reduce basement flooding.
Foundation crack repair - addresses structural issues that can lead to leaks and water intrusion.
Waterproofing membranes - create a barrier to keep moisture out of basement spaces.
Sump pump installation - helps remove accumulated water and protect against basement flooding.
Interior waterproofing - involves sealing walls and floors to keep basements dry and mold-free.
Leaking Basement Repair Questions
What causes basement leaks? Basement leaks can result from poor drainage, foundation cracks, or plumbing issues that allow water to seep through walls or floors.
How can I tell if my basement is leaking? Signs include damp walls, musty odors, water stains, or visible puddles on the floor after rain or snowmelt.
What types of repairs are common for leaking basements? Repairs often involve sealing cracks, installing sump pumps, or applying waterproof coatings to prevent water intrusion.
Is waterproofing necessary for all basements? Waterproofing is recommended for basements prone to moisture, especially in areas with high water tables or poor drainage around the property.
